Whether BetterHelp takes insurance is: it depends. BetterHelp is not a service provider of insurance coverage, but it does work with some insurance provider and worker support programs (EAPs) to provide coverage for treatment services. The specifics of what insurance coverage business and EAPs BetterHelp works with, and what services they cover, can differ widely depending on the specific policy.

Rather, BetterHelp is a platform that connects people with licensed therapists who supply online treatment services. As a result, the concern of whether BetterHelp takes insurance coverage is somewhat complicated.

To figure out whether your insurance policy will cover treatment services supplied through BetterHelp, you’ll need to contact your insurance provider directly. Some insurance coverage may cover online treatment services, while others may not. Furthermore, even if your insurance coverage does cover online therapy, it might not cover services offered through BetterHelp particularly. To learn whether your insurance policy will cover therapy services offered through BetterHelp, you’ll require to contact your insurance provider straight.

BetterHelp also works with some EAPs to offer protection for treatment services. EAPs normally use a range of services, consisting of therapy and therapy services.

Simply as with insurance coverage policies, the specifics of what EAPs cover can differ widely depending on the specific policy. Some EAPs may cover therapy services provided through BetterHelp, while others may not. Furthermore, even if your EAP does cover therapy services offered through BetterHelp, it might just cover a certain variety of sessions or might just cover a portion of the expense of each session. To discover whether your EAP covers treatment services provided through BetterHelp, you’ll need to contact your EAP directly.

It is necessary to note that even if your insurance policy or EAP does cover treatment services supplied through BetterHelp, you may still be responsible for paying some part of the cost of each session. Insurance policies and EAPs typically have deductibles, copays, or coinsurance requirements that you’ll require to satisfy prior to your protection begins. In addition, if your therapist is out of network for your insurance coverage or EAP, you might be responsible for a higher portion of the expense of each session.

Recommendation Codes

Another method to access discounts on online therapy services is through recommendation codes. Lots of online therapy platforms offer referral programs that reward both the person and the referrer being referred with discounts on treatment services.

BetterHelp offers a recommendation program that provides a $50 credit for both the person referring and the person being referred. This credit can be applied to future treatment sessions, reducing the general expense of services.

To take advantage of a recommendation code, you’ll normally need to register for an account with the online therapy platform and enter the code at checkout or in your account settings. Once you’ve gone into the code, the discount will be applied to your account, and you can start using it to access treatment services.

Discount Programs

In addition to podcast codes and referral codes, numerous online treatment platforms provide discount rate programs for particular groups of people. For example, some platforms use discounts for students, military personnel, or first responders.

Talkspace, for instance, offers a 50% discount rate for the first month of services for all military workers, veterans, and their households. This type of discount program can be an excellent way to make treatment services more accessible for people who may have limited financial resources.

To access a discount program, you’ll typically need to supply evidence of your eligibility. This might consist of a trainee ID, military ID, or other documentation that validates your status as a member of the qualified group.
